What is a Mobile Car Key Locksmith?
A mobile car key locksmith is an expert service technician who concentrates on car key-related services. Unlike conventional locksmith professionals who run from a fixed location, mobile locksmiths use the flexibility of taking a trip directly to their consumers.
They come equipped with all the essential tools and innovation to repair, replace, or program car keys on the spot, and they supply support at any location-- whether that's at home, work, or stranded on the side of the road.
Core Services Offered by Mobile Car Key Locksmiths
The scope of services offered by mobile car key locksmith professionals extends far beyond just cutting keys. They cater to a wide variety of key and security-related problems. Here are a few of the most common services:
Key Replacement
- Lost your car keys? Mobile locksmith professionals can develop a new key for you, typically without requiring an initial key for referral.
- Solutions include both standard metal keys and modern remote fobs and transponder keys.
Key Programming & & Reprogramming
- Modern cars and trucks utilize transponder or clever keys that require programming to interact with the vehicle's built-in immobilizer.
- Mobile locksmith professionals are equipped with advanced diagnostic tools to program or reprogram these keys on-site.
Emergency Situation Lockout Assistance
- Locked out of your car? Mobile locksmith professionals use non-destructive entry strategies to access without damaging your vehicle.
Broken Key Extraction
- Keys can break within ignition cylinders or door locks, leaving you stranded. Mobile locksmiths have the essential tools to get rid of broken key fragments securely.
Ignition Repair and Replacement
- If the ignition mechanism is malfunctioning, whether due to a jammed key or wear and tear, mobile locksmiths can repair or replace it.
Spare Key Duplication
- Want a backup key for emergencies? Mobile locksmith professionals can develop duplicates on the go, customized to your particular vehicle model.

FAQs About Mobile Car Key Locksmiths
1. Are mobile car key locksmith professionals expensive?Mobile locksmith services are normally budget-friendly. While expenses may vary depending upon the service and car design, lots of find it more cost-efficient due to the elimination of towing fees and their competitive prices. 2. Can a mobile locksmith make a key without the original?Yes! Advanced technology permitslocksmiths to generate a brand-new key by utilizing the vehicle's
VIN( Vehicle Identification Number )or by deciphering the lock system. 3. The length of time does it require to replace a car key?On average, replacing or programming a car key
takes 30-- 60 minutes, though this can vary based upon the car model and the intricacy of the service. 4. Are mobile locksmiths offered 24/7? Most mobile locksmiths operate 24/7, providing help for emergencies at any time of
day or night. 5. What should I do if my car key breaks in the
lock?Avoid requiring it further into the lock or attempting DIY repairs. Call a mobile locksmith to safely extract the broken key and examine the damage.
